London: Sampson Low, Marston, Searle & Rivington, 1882. First Edition. Hardcover. Very Good +. FIRST EDITION, 1882. THREE VOLUME SET. This book comes from the library of Maurice Sendak. Sendak was a prominent author and illustrator of children's books best know for his book "Where the Wild Things Are". He was a recipient of the Hans Christian Anderson Award for his lasting contribution to children's literature. Sendak was a collector of George MacDonald books. Like most of Sendak's books, this copy does not contain Sendak's bookplate but comes with a certificate from the auction firm which establishes the provenance of the book. Three volumes in the original brown cloth boards with a black border on the front cover. Gilt text on the spine. Volume 1 has a frontispiece. 334, 307 plus 32p of ads, 374 pp. Shaberman 69. Minor wear at extremities and bumped corners. Binding are solid. Small stickers inside front covers but no names. Due to the size and weight of this set, an additional shipping charge may apply.
